From what we learned, the Xiaomi Redmi 7 Pro and its sibling can arrive soon this month with 6GB RAM, 48MP camera and more. Check it out!
Xiaomi Redmi 7 Pro arriving
According to the latest updates, an unannounced Xiaomi smartphone was certified by the 3C certification agency in China. In details, the Xiaomi device comes with model numbers M1901F7E, M1901F7T, and M1901F7C. Moreover, the smartphone has now been spotted on TENAA and MIIT websites. At the moment, the marketing name is unknown, but it is possible to be an upcoming Redmi 7 series smartphone.
Based on the TENAA listings, Xiaomi Redmi 7 Pro specs feature a large 6.3-inch sized display. Regarding the size, the handset measures 159.21 x 75.21 x 8.1mm. Moreover, keeping the light is a massive 3900mAh capacity battery. Meanwhile, the M1901F9T (Redmi 7) features a 5.84-inch display and a 2900mAh battery. Notably, the company has confirmed to launch a Redmi phone with a whopping 48MP rear camera.
From what we learned, the smartphone may use the same Sony IMX586 48MP sensor used in the Huawei Nova 4 and Honor V20 smartphones. According to earlier reports, the Redmi 7 Pro takes power from Qualcomm Snapdragon 632 chipset. Furthermore, the Redmi 7 Pro comes with 3GB/ 4GB/ 6GB RAM and 32GB/ 64GB/ 128GB ROM (expandable up to 256GB). Imaging-wise, the Xiaomi Redmi 7 Pro camera features an 8MP front-facing shooter for selfies and video calls. Also, the device would work on Android Pie 9.0.

The upcoming Samsung Galaxy M30 can hit the market with a huge 5000mAh battery, three rear cameras. Scroll down for further information!
Samsung Galaxy M30 specs
As we learned, the South Korean brand is gearing to launch three new members in the M-series smartphone in the Indian market this month. In details, it includes the Samsung Galaxy M10, the Galaxy M20, and the Galaxy M30. Today, we’re bringing you the information about one of these phones, the Galaxy M30. According to the latest report, the Samsung Galaxy M30 camera comes with a similar camera to the Samsung Galaxy A7.
On the back, the Galaxy M30 carries a triple-lens camera. It consists of a primary 13MP sensor and two 5MP sensors. Additionally, the 5MP snappers can be an ultra-wide and depth unit. Besides that, for taking selfies and video calling, there is a single 16MP front-facing shooter. Keeping the light of this phone is a huge 5000mAh juice box. As we can know, the sibling Samsung Galaxy M20 also packs the same battery capacity.
On the other side, in terms of the display, the Samsung Galaxy M30 specs flaunt a 6.38-inch Infinity-U display with a resolution of 1080 x 2280 pixels. Under the hood, this phone also features a small chin, and a waterdrop-like notch. Furthermore, hardware-wise, the Galaxy M30 takes power from the Samsung Exynos 7 Octa, paired with 4GB RAM and 64GB/ 128GB of internal storage. Moreover, the storage can be upgradable.
